Tasting New Fruits Location - my house Date - June 24, 2025 Fruit #1: Kiwi I tried kiwi for the first time today. I bought one from Publix. They all looked the same to me, and I don't know how to pick a ripe kiwi, so I picked one from the display almost at random. I washed it and then sliced it. I decided to eat it with the skin on (the internet said it was fine to eat it with or without the skin). It was pretty good. A bit more acidic/tart than I expected, and it certainly had an interesting texture (from the skin, I think). However, I did enjoy it overall. It kind of tasted like the combination of a strawberry and a pear. Kiwis are the most prominent fruit from their family, Actinidiaceae, and are classified as berries. Fruit #2: Apricot The next fruit I tried was the apricot, which I also bought from Publix. It was quite tasty, I really enjoyed it.
